Friday, February 9th, 2007
Poetry Daily
Congrats to E.G. Burrows (who I don’t think even owns a computer, so definitely isn’t reading this) for having his poem from issue #26, “Coast Road” selected by Poetry Daily. Burrows was part of our tribute to the Greatest Generation. Cheers, E.G.
